Digital Transformation

This evolution of healthcare involves using technology to improve diagnosis, treatments, monitor patients, enhance hospital operations and culture, and bolster consumer-focused care. This includes virtual reality tools, wearable devices, workflow software, health apps and other digital health tools.

Apple's new watch can conduct an ECG in 30 seconds

Apple has disrupted its share of technology-based markets before—from the home computer to the phone. The latest product from the global behemoth has set its sights on cardiology. The new Apple Watch Series 4 comes with an FDA-approved electrocardiogram (ECG) feature.
